Tips

To deepen Will's learning, organize a mock town‑hall where he debates new safety regulations based on the video’s scenario, encouraging research into real‑world case studies. Follow up with a timeline project that maps major transportation accidents and the resulting policy shifts, reinforcing cause‑and‑effect reasoning. Incorporate a role‑play activity where Will assumes the perspective of a 19th‑century engineer versus a modern regulator, fostering empathy for historical and contemporary viewpoints. Finally, have him write a short persuasive essay on why proactive safety measures matter, using evidence from the video and historical examples.
